One in three Democrats think President Joe Biden should withdraw from running for a second term after last week’s disastrous debate with Donald Trump. However, no Democrat-elect would fare better than Biden in a hypothetical showdown with Trump on Nov. 5, according to a Reuters/Ipsos poll. The two-day poll found both Trump, 78, and Biden, 81, securing the support of 40 percent of registered voters, meaning the Democratic president did not lose ground after the debate. Of the top Democrats, in a hypothetical “battle” with Trump, only Michelle Obama, the wife of former president Barack Obama, would do better than Biden: she would garner 50% to 39% for Trump.
